Energy efficiency

A double-pane glass consists of two glass panes that are sealed hermetically and separated by a spacer or a strip of metal. This gap is filled with a non-toxic inert gas, such as argon or Krypton to reduce conduction and double glazing near me improve efficiency in energy use. Window frames and sash materials can also impact energy efficiency with wooden and composite frames typically being more efficient than aluminum or vinyl ones.

A high-quality, energy-efficient window can cut down your energy bill substantially. According to the EPA the single-paned windows can save around 12 percent of energy consumption. However, double-paned windows can reduce energy usage by as much as 50 percent. You can combine double-paned windows and other home improvements to maximize your energy savings.

If you notice condensation between your double-glazed windows It is a sign that the seal between the two panes has failed. This means the insulating gas (usually argon) has leaked and moisture is building up between the glass. Additionally, the condensation can cause further issues like damp and draughts in the home.

It is essential to maintain low humidity levels in the home. This is especially important when washing dishes or cooking. It is also an excellent idea to install extractor fans in kitchens and bathrooms as they can aid in keeping the humidity low. Double glazing can reduce the amount of condensation that develops in your home by reducing the temperature differences between the outside and inside of the home. It is not a substitute for ventilation and it is vital to have some form of draught proofing inside the home. It is possible to achieve this by installing a second window, or by installing a trickle-vent.
